Concussion substitution being used at 2021 CONCACAF Gold Cup!

CONCACAF is using the IFAB additional permanent “concussion substitutes” in the 2021 CONCACAF Gold Cup with the implementation of Protocol B enforced throughout the competition. Under Protocol B, each team is permitted to use a maximum of two “concussion substitutes” in a match. A “concussion substitution” may be used regardless …
